Output 68afa616200f173e6e722a2124d4c6c945a9fd707191a6d949ff511b5ea4aa87:0

value
33327797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80350c4a6c59cad39bf2b0ff0369cdff64e0d05b OP_EQUAL
address
MKb4Gpo8rJh9Y7quhMsBz1vsDoJfZmbUq6
transaction
68afa616200f173e6e722a2124d4c6c945a9fd707191a6d949ff511b5ea4aa87
spent
true